返回

表情达意:打造个性化表情键盘

Android

拥抱个性化:自定义表情键盘让沟通更生动

在社交媒体盛行的时代,表情符号已成为我们交流中不可或缺的一部分。从传神的笑脸到可爱的动物,这些小小的图案能够跨越语言的藩篱,瞬间传递情绪和想法。

然而,现有的表情库往往难以满足我们日益个性化的表达需求。为此,自定义表情键盘应运而生,让我们可以打造属于自己的表情王国。

技术挑战:征服表情符号与文本的转换

打造一套功能强大的自定义表情键盘需要攻克一系列技术难关,其中最核心的当属系统键盘和表情键盘的无缝切换,以及富文本的处理。

富文本的处理 涉及两个关键环节:

  • 文本转表情: 如何将输入的文本内容转换成对应的表情符号,这需要建立起文本与表情之间的映射关系。
  • 表情转文本: 则是将表情符号还原为可编辑的文本内容,同样需要建立起表情与文本之间的对应关系。

系统键盘与表情键盘的切换 考验着开发者对于界面交互和系统底层的理解。表情键盘作为一种特殊的输入方式,需要与系统键盘无缝切换,以保证用户在不同输入模式下的流畅操作体验。

细节的考验:打造无坑体验

在开发自定义表情键盘的过程中,细节繁多,稍有不慎便会陷入各种坑中。例如:

  • 不同平台对表情符号的支持程度不一,这就要求开发者针对不同的平台进行适配。
  • 表情符号的编码方式也是一个需要注意的细节,不同的编码方式可能会导致表情符号在不同设备上的显示差异。

满足用户需求:打造个性化表达天地

打造一套优秀的自定义表情键盘,不仅需要深厚的技术功底,更需要对用户需求的深刻洞察。表情键盘的个性化定制功能是其一大亮点,开发者需要提供丰富的表情素材供用户选择,同时也要保证这些素材能够满足不同用户的审美偏好。

我们的创新与优化:打破限制,赋能个性

在开发之初,我们以小红书的表情键盘为参考,并在此基础上进行了诸多创新和优化。我们的表情键盘支持多种表情素材的导入,包括图片、GIF动图和视频,用户可以根据自己的喜好自由搭配。同时,我们还提供了强大的表情编辑功能,允许用户对表情的大小、位置和透明度进行调整,打造出独一无二的表情组合。

除了满足用户个性化表达需求之外,我们的表情键盘还十分注重与其他应用的兼容性。我们采用了跨平台的开发方案,确保表情键盘能够在主流的移动操作系统和桌面系统中无缝使用。

用户体验至上:打造流畅沟通体验

用户体验是我们在开发过程中始终贯彻的理念。我们对表情键盘的交互方式进行了精心设计,让用户能够在不同输入场景下轻松切换表情键盘。此外,我们还提供了丰富的快捷键和手势操作,帮助用户快速找到所需表情,提升输入效率。

成果展示:大受欢迎,业界认可

在经过多次测试和迭代之后,我们的表情键盘终于正式上线。它受到了广大用户的喜爱,并得到了业界的广泛认可。我们的表情键盘被评为年度最佳移动应用,并在各大应用商店中获得了极高的评分。

展望未来:持续探索,无限可能

表情键盘的开发是一段充满挑战和收获的旅程。我们不断探索新技术,优化用户体验,只为给用户带来更加个性化、更加生动有趣的社交体验。未来,我们将继续深耕表情键盘领域,为用户提供更多创新功能和优质服务。

常见问题解答:

1. 表情符号怎么转文本?

表情符号转文本需要建立表情与文本之间的对应关系。可以通过查表或使用现成的库来实现。

2. 怎么保证表情符号在不同平台上都能正常显示?

需要针对不同的平台进行适配,使用平台支持的编码方式来表示表情符号。

3. 表情键盘能自定义到什么程度?

表情键盘通常支持导入自定义表情素材,并提供表情编辑功能,允许用户调整表情的大小、位置和透明度。

4. 怎么确保表情键盘与其他应用兼容?

采用跨平台的开发方案,使用系统提供的 API 来实现与其他应用的交互。

5. 表情键盘使用有什么需要注意的?

注意不同平台对表情符号的支持程度,在输入表情时避免使用不支持的表情符号。此外,注意表情素材的版权,避免使用侵权的表情素材。